How do people make the dirt paths though?
 
You just have to plan out where you want your paths to be and how wide you want them to be, and run/walk over them a few times a day, saving and quitting in between each time.c:
 
You just have to plan out where you want your paths to be and how wide you want them to be, and run/walk over them a few times a day, saving and quitting in between each time.c:
